Title: Bally Alpha Elite S9C problems after battery change
Post by: Canaslot on March 29, 2021, 12:31:21 PM
I changed all three batteries in my Bally Alpha Elite 5 reel, with 6.3 inch touch panel, 512 MPU .  Now I have no signal on the display, the MPU buzzes, the reels continuously spin, the led readouts on the MPU show 88 and nothing happens.  I changed the power supply on the MPU.  I double checked the batteries and they are correctly installed, powered up the MPU unplugged from the back plane, switched the ATX switch on and off, tried the clear card and nothing seems to help.  I plugged in a computer monitor to the VGA port and get no picture.
The OS card is AVOS00000336-09The Clear Card is AVOCLEAR0335-01   I am beginning to believe the MPU has crapped out.  Any suggestions  would appreciated.

Post by: Canaslot on August 02, 2021, 09:01:18 PM
IT Lives.  After 3 months, I finally had time to dig into the Bally S9000 problems.  I found these problems:  NVRAM was corrupt, that annoying 512 buzzing was present,  it wouldn't boot up, the 6.3 LCD kept flashing no signal, no video signal from the MPU therefore an external monitor was no help. 
The problem of the 6.3 LCD not working was the one thing that I could not find any repair info on.  I pulled the LCD monitor out and started looking for anything that was visibility wrong and I found the 35 volt 220 mfd cap with the top blown out on the power board.  I replaced that cap and the LCD worked again.  However, the MPU was still buzzing and not booting up.  After some digging on this site, thanks to Fireball Jackpot, I found some answers to the 512 buzzing.  Thanks to RB for the 807 bios chip, clear and OS cards, I finally was able to revive the Alpha Elite.  Also thanks to Jim at Bettor slots for the easy instructions to re-install the TITO.
I hope this helps anyone else that needs help.
ps I now keep the machine plugged into a good UPS with surge protection.
